Japan women qualify for Olympics soccer in top spot

Japan women qualify for Olympics soccer in top spot

JINAN, China - Japan's 11 players pose for photos after beating China 1-0 in a women's soccer Asian qualifier for the 2012 London Olympics, in Jinan, China, on Sept. 11, 2011. Japan, having already secured one of the two spots up for grabs for the Olympics, finished in top spot in the six-team round-robin competition with four wins and a draw, earning 13 points.

Yamazaki, Japanese doctor in China, dies at 102

Yamazaki, Japanese doctor in China, dies at 102

TOKYO, Japan - File photo shows Japanese doctor Hiroshi Yamazaki, who died on Dec. 1, 2010, in Jinan, China's Shandong Province, at the age of 102. Yamazaki, an Okayama Prefecture native, dedicated his life and career to provide medical service for people in China. He was a veterinarian in the now-defunct Japanese military and stayed in China after the end of World War II.
